After install the zesty daily image and reboot, the system will complain
about "no boot device".
Looks like it's a BIOS issue, but I think it's better to log it here for
future reference. This issue can be reproduced on Dell E7250
(201408-15387) BIOS rev A04 as well.
Solution:
1. Go to "Boot Sequence" section in the BIOS, manually add the boot entry with
"Add Boot Option" button.
2. Select the grubx64.efi in EFI/ubuntu directory
Also, on this system (E5450), this issue has gone after BIOS upgrade to
the latest rev A14 and reinstall zesty.
